深入解析Vmess协议:安全性与隐私保护的现代解决方案

首页 / 新闻资讯 / 正文

引言

在当今高度互联的数字时代,隐私保护和网络安全问题日益受到关注。无论是个人用户还是企业,都面临着数据泄露、网络监控和审查的威胁。为了应对这些挑战,各种加密传输协议应运而生,其中 Vmess(V2Ray Messaging Protocol)因其高效、灵活和强大的安全性而备受推崇。本文将从技术原理、加密机制、伪装能力、潜在风险等多个角度深入探讨Vmess的安全性,并与其他主流协议进行对比,帮助读者全面了解这一协议的优势与适用场景。


一、Vmess协议的核心工作原理

Vmess是V2Ray框架的核心传输协议,旨在通过多层次的加密和认证机制,确保数据传输的安全性和隐蔽性。其工作流程可以概括为以下几个关键环节:

1. 加密机制

Vmess支持多种现代加密算法,包括 AES-128/256-GCMChaCha20-Poly1305,这些算法在密码学领域被广泛认可,能够有效防止数据被窃取或篡改。所有传输的数据都会经过加密处理,只有持有正确密钥的接收方才能解密。

2. 身份验证与防中间人攻击

Vmess采用 动态ID(UUID) 作为身份验证的核心机制,确保只有合法的客户端能够与服务器建立连接。此外,Vmess还支持 TLS(Transport Layer Security) 加密,进一步防止中间人攻击(MITM),确保通信双方的身份真实可信。

3. 流量伪装技术

Vmess的一个显著特点是其 流量伪装(Obfuscation) 能力。通过模拟正常的HTTPS流量或WebSocket通信,Vmess可以有效规避深度包检测(DPI),使得网络审查系统难以识别和阻断其流量。这一特性使其在严格网络管控的环境下(如某些地区)仍能保持较高的可用性。

4. 数据完整性保护

Vmess使用 消息认证码(MAC) 技术,确保数据在传输过程中未被篡改。接收方可以通过校验MAC值来验证数据的完整性,防止恶意攻击者注入虚假信息或修改数据包。


二、Vmess的安全性分析

1. 加密算法的可靠性

Vmess所采用的加密算法(如AES、ChaCha20)均经过严格的密码学验证,目前尚未发现有效的破解方法。尤其是 ChaCha20,由于其高效性和对移动设备的优化,已成为许多现代加密协议的首选。

2. 动态ID与防追踪

Vmess的 动态ID机制 使得每次连接的认证信息都不同,有效防止了长期追踪。相较于静态密钥的协议(如Shadowsocks),Vmess在防关联性上更具优势。

3. 抗审查能力

Vmess的流量伪装技术使其能够绕过常见的网络审查手段。例如,通过 WebSocket + TLS 的组合,Vmess流量可以伪装成正常的网页浏览行为,从而避免被封锁。

4. 潜在安全风险与应对措施

尽管Vmess具有较高的安全性,但仍存在一些潜在风险:
- 账户泄露风险:如果用户的UUID或配置信息被泄露,攻击者可能利用这些信息进行恶意连接。
- 解决方案:定期更换UUID,避免在公共场合分享配置信息。
- 协议特征检测:某些高级防火墙可能通过流量特征识别Vmess流量。
- 解决方案:结合更高级的伪装技术(如V2Ray的VLESS协议或Trojan协议)以增强隐蔽性。


三、Vmess与其他协议的对比

| 协议 | 加密方式 | 伪装能力 | 安全性 | 性能 |
|-------------|------------------|------------|----------|---------|
| Vmess | AES/ChaCha20 | 强(支持TLS+WebSocket) | 高 | 优秀 |
| Shadowsocks | AES/Chacha20 | 弱(需额外插件支持) | 中 | 中等 |
| OpenVPN | AES(默认) | 中等(依赖TLS) | 中高 | 中等 |
| Trojan | TLS加密 | 强(完全伪装成HTTPS) | 极高 | 优秀 |

从对比中可以看出,Vmess在 安全性、伪装能力和性能 方面均表现优异,尤其适合需要高隐蔽性和稳定连接的用户。


四、如何安全使用Vmess

  1. 定期更新配置:建议每隔一段时间更换UUID和服务器端口,以减少被探测的风险。
  2. 启用TLS加密:结合TLS可以大幅提升安全性,防止流量被嗅探。
  3. 避免使用公开节点:公共Vmess节点可能已被监控,建议自建服务器或使用可信赖的服务提供商。
  4. 监控异常连接:通过日志分析,及时发现并阻断异常访问。

五、结论

Vmess协议凭借其 强大的加密、灵活的伪装技术和高效的数据传输,成为当前科学上网工具中的佼佼者。尽管它并非绝对完美,但在合理配置和使用的情况下,能够为用户提供极高的隐私保护和网络自由。对于追求安全性与稳定性的用户而言,Vmess无疑是一个值得信赖的选择。

未来,随着网络审查技术的升级,Vmess及其衍生协议(如VLESS)可能会进一步优化,以应对更复杂的网络环境。用户也应保持对新技术的学习,以确保自身数据的安全。


精彩点评

Vmess协议的设计体现了现代网络安全技术的精髓——在性能与安全之间找到平衡。它不仅提供了军用级加密,还通过流量伪装巧妙规避审查,堪称“网络自由战士”的利器。然而,正如所有工具一样,其安全性最终取决于使用者的操作。唯有保持警惕、合理配置,才能真正发挥Vmess的最大价值。

(全文约2200字)